Rare '90s Zelda Comic Getting Official Re-release, Check Out the New Cover

The comic series from legendary artist Ishinomori will be available again in May for the first time in over two decades.

25 Comments
No Caption Provided

If you were a Nintendo Power subscriber back in 1992, you probably remember a series of The Legend of Zelda comics drawn by manga artist Shotaro Ishinomori that retold the story of A Link to the Past. But outside of a standalone book for subscribers, the series has been out of print for over two decades.

Luckily, Viz comics is gearing up for a re-issue. The original appeared as a serial through issues of the Nintendo Power magazine before being offered as a standalone paperback. On Ebay, those original printings sell for $40 to $50.

Viz showed off the new cover for the book and a release date of 5/5/15 through a post on Twitter.
